以太坊钱包合约避坑指南
2026-03-14
以太坊(Ethereum)是一种开源的区块链平台,允许开发者在其上创建和部署智能合约与去中心化应用(DApps)。作为以太坊生态系统的重要组成部分,以太坊钱包合约在数字资产管理和操作中扮演着关键角色。通过钱包合约,用户可以更加高效、安全地进行资产交易、存储和管理,在当前快速发展的区块链环境中显得尤为重要。
### 2. 钱包合约的基础知识 #### 什么是钱包合约钱包合约是基于区块链技术的一种智能合约,主要用于管理加密货币和数字资产。与传统的钱包不同,钱包合约不仅仅是简单的数字资产存储工具,它们还能够执行复杂的逻辑和事务处理。这种合约可以自动化资产转移、执行条件触发的操作等,从而提升用户的管理效率。
#### 钱包合约的类型钱包合约有多种类型,包括但不限于多重签名钱包、时间锁钱包和去中心化交易所钱包等。每种钱包合约都有其独特的功能和适用场景。例如,多重签名钱包需要多个密钥来共同进行交易,增加了安全性,而时间锁钱包则可以设置资产锁定的时间,以增强资金管理的灵活性。
#### 钱包合约的运行机制钱包合约的运行机制基于区块链技术,所有的操作和交易记录在区块链上不可篡改地保存。用户通过调用合约中的函数,与合约进行交互,实现数字资产的管理和转移。每一次交易都需要通过网络节点的验证,从而确保整个过程的安全和透明。
### 3. 避坑指南 #### 常见的错误使用场景在使用钱包合约的过程中,用户可能会遇到各种误区,比如错误理解合约逻辑、未仔细检查交易信息等。例如,有些用户提交交易时未注意到矿工费的变化,导致交易未能成功被确认。此外,盲目转账给未知的合约地址也可能导致资产永久丢失。
#### 如何识别和避免错误要识别和避免错误,用户需对钱包合约的功能有深入了解,并保持对市场动态的关注。使用官方、社区推荐的合约版本,避免使用不明来源的合约。此外,定期进行合约安全审计也是预防错误的重要手段。
#### 实际案例分析例如,某用户因使用了一个冒名的合约导致全部资产被盗。该合约声称提供高额收益,但实际上是一个典型的“黑客合约”。在深入了解合约的过程中,用户后期才意识到该合约中存在严重的漏洞与风险。由此可见,选择钱包合约时务必提高警惕。
### 4. 更新常见问题 #### 升级过程中的常见问题在进行钱包合约的升级时,用户常会遇到数据丢失或合约不兼容等问题。为了避免这些麻烦,用户应提前做好数据备份,同时仔细阅读官方文档,了解各版本之间的差异和兼容性。
#### 如何确保数据安全确保数据安全的关键在于定期备份和验证合约的真实来源。使用知名开发团队发布的合约,同时保持本地备份文件的完整性也至关重要。此外,配合使用硬件钱包可以提升资产的安全性。
#### 升级前后的功能变化在升级合约后,用户可能会发现某些功能的变化,或者新增的功能需要额外的操作步骤。此时,用户应仔细体验新版本,深入了解其功能的实现原理,并针对新问题进行快速学习与适应。
### 5. 别升错版本 #### 版本选择的重要性钱包合约的版本选择对用户体验和安全性至关重要。不正确的版本可能导致合约功能失效,甚至面临资产安全风险。因此,用户需保持对最新版本信息的关注,尽量使用有良好口碑的合约版本。
#### 版本选择中的注意事项在选择版本时,用户应考虑合约的使用情况、社区反馈及开发者的支持度等多个维度。通过社区讨论和专业评测来判断哪些版本更加稳定和安全。
#### 如何判断最新版本的稳定性判断最新版本的稳定性需要充分浏览相关文档、社区讨论以及用户反馈。用户可以在GitHub、论坛等平台查看版本更新日志,关注Bug修复和功能,了解版本的实际运行情况。
### 6. 总结与展望钱包合约是以太坊生态系统中不可或缺的一部分,其正确使用与安全管理直接影响用户的资产安全。未来,随着技术的不断演进,钱包合约将在安全性、可用性和功能性上持续提升,为用户提供更为优质的服务。
### 7. 相关问题探讨 #### 如何选择合适的钱包合约?选择合适的钱包合约首先要理解自己的需求。用户需要明确自己使用钱包合约的主要目的,例如储存、交易、还是参与某些DeFi项目。其次,用户应关注合约的安全性和开发者的信誉。建议查看合约的Auditing报告以及社区意见,确保选择的合约经过专业的安全审计,并获得用户的良好反馈。此外,用户还需考虑界面的易用性和是否兼容于常用的数字货币。
#### 在使用钱包合约时需要注意哪些安全问题?在使用钱包合约时,安全问题尤为重要。首先,应避免点击不明链接和分享个人私钥,防止钓鱼攻击。其次,用户应定期检查自己的合约地址和交易记录,及时发现异常情况。使用硬件钱包可以进一步提升资产安全性。此外,定期更新软件和合约,确保使用的是最新版本,有助于防止安全漏洞。用户还应了解合约的风险,尤其是那些高收益的合约,更需谨慎。
#### 钱包合约的版本升级有什么风险?版本升级可能带来一系列风险,包括但不限于功能不兼容、数据丢失和安全漏洞等。在升级前,用户必须进行充分的准备工作,比如备份现有合约的数据,并了解新版本的功能特点及其潜在风险。此外,合约的升级应该在社区讨论和专业建议的基础上进行,确保升级后的合约能够长期稳定运行。同时,用户也应关注版本升级的通知和相关信息,这对保持合约的安全性和功能稳定性至关重要。
#### 如何进行钱包合约的备份与恢复?备份钱包合约的过程相对简单,用户需定期保存合约的关键数据,比如私钥和合约地址。在数字资产管理中,私钥的安全非常重要,泄露可能导致资产的彻底丢失。用户可以选择将私钥存储在安全的地方,或使用专门的软件进行加密。另外,恢复钱包合约操作也需要遵循正确流程,确保按步骤输入备份的信息,以便顺利恢复合约。因此,保持良好的备份习惯是用户一定要养成的。
#### 如何快速识别合约中的异常行为?识别合约中的异常行为通常需要借助区块链浏览器及相关工具。用户应定期监控合约的交易记录,对比正常的交易模式和异常行为,例如频繁的高额转账、突然的合约调用等。此外,参与社区讨论可以帮助用户了解他人的经历,从而提高对可疑活动的警戒性。对合约的代码进行分析,也有助于发现潜在的安全漏洞和异常功能。因此,更新自己的知识库是至关重要的。
#### 社区在钱包合约的发展中扮演什么角色?社区对钱包合约的发展起着至关重要的作用。首先,社区提供了一个信息共享的平台,用户可以在此讨论合约的具体细节、功能和潜在风险。其次,社区的反馈能够给开发者提供改进产品的建议和方向,促进合约的不断。用户通过参与社区投票和讨论,能够对合约的未来发展方向产生积极影响。总之,活跃的社区不仅能增强用户的粘性,还能推动整个生态系统的协作与发展。
--- 以上内容围绕以太坊钱包合约进行深入探讨,涵盖了其基础知识、使用中的常见问题及解决方案,并提供了详细的应对策略。希望这些信息能帮助读者更好地理解和使用以太坊钱包合约,提升资产管理的安全性和效率。